History and development:
Internet poker emerged in the belated 1990s due to developments in technology plus the internet. The first online Poker Casino area,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a little but passionate neighborhood. But was in the first 2000s that online poker experienced exponential growth, mainly because of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Popularity and Accessibility:
One of the main reasons behind the immense rise in popularity of on-line poker is its accessibility. Players can log on to their most favorite internet poker systems whenever you want, from anywhere, utilizing their computer systems or mobile devices. This convenience has actually attracted a varied player base, which range from recreational players to specialists, leading to the rapid expansion of online poker.

Features of Internet Poker:
Internet poker provides several advantages over old-fashioned br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Firstly, it offers a wider selection of game choices, including various poker variations and stakes, providing towards the choices and budgets of types of people. In addition, internet poker rooms are available 24/7, getting rid of the constraints of real casino working hours. In addition, on the web systems often provide attractive incentives, respect programs, as well as the ability to play numerous tables simultaneously, boosting the overall gaming experience.
